Best cat-back exhaust system for single cat 89
 
Been looking for a good cat-back system for my 89 TTA. From what I can tell so far, it appears the TTA utilized a standard 305/350 system from the cat back with the 2 bolt flange up front with the exception being the TTA tips at the back. I can reuse my tips and attach to a new system or get new tips that look similar (more likely) so I can put away the OEM system in the attic.

Magnaflow and a few others have oversized polished tailpipes which aren't ideal to adapt my TTA tips. The Hooker kit looks like the best option and coincidently is the cheapest. It's "aluminized" but these cars don't go outside if there's a raindrop nor in winter so my other "Aluminzed" systems have lasted indefinitely.

However, PYPES doesn't seem to support these 3rd gen cars at all based on their website findings. What are you folks with 3rd gen cars running and what fits well, has high quality and sounds great?
